Compute contracts are agreements that allocate processing power, often via cloud or blockchain networks, specifying cost, duration, and performance. Users—AI firms, researchers, and startups—rent scalable resources without owning hardware, while providers monetize idle capacity. They enable flexible, cost-efficient access to high-performance computing.
